Q:

How many 3-digit numbers can be formed with the digits 1,4,7,8 and 9 if the digits are not repeated ?

A) 60 B) 26
C) 50 D) 64
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: A) 60

Explanation:

Three digit number will have unit’s, ten’s and hundred’s place.

 

Out of 5 given digits any one can take the unit’s place.

 

This can be done in 5 ways. ...              (i)

 

After filling the unit’s place, any of the four remaining digits can take the ten’s place.

 

This can be done in 4 ways. ...              (ii)

 

After filling in ten’s place, hundred’s place can be filled from any of the three remaining digits.

 

This can be done in 3 ways. ... (iii) 

 

So,by counting principle, the number of 3 digit numbers = 5x 4 x 3 = 60

Q:

What is the probability that a couple with four children have atleast one girl?

A) 0.0625 B) 0.9375
C) 0.5 D) 0.0257
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: B) 0.9375

Explanation:

Here,n = 4(children)

P(girl)= 0.5

P(of atleast one girl)= 1 - P(no girls)

                             = 1 - 0.0625 = 0.9375

Q:

Change Active Voice to Passive Voice?

Active voice : Has he completed the work?

Answer

Passive Voice : Has the work been completed by him?


 


Rules in changing from Active voice to Passive voice :


1. Identify the subject, the verb and the object: S+V+O


2. Change the object into subject


3. Put the suitable helping verb or auxiliary verb


4. Change the verb into past participle of the verb


5. Add the preposition "by"


6. Change the subject into object.

Q:

Relation Between Efficiencies

6 boys and 8 girls finish a job in 6 days and 14 boys and 10 girls finish the same job in 4 days. In how many days working together 1 boy and 1 girl can finish the work?

Answer

Sol : In this kind of questions we find the work force required to complete the work in 1 day (or given unit of time) then we equate the work force to find the relationship between the efficiencies (or work rate) between the different workers.


 


Therefore, 6B+8G = 6 days


 => 6(6B+8G)= 1 day  (inversely proportional)


 => 36B+48G =1         ( by unitary method)


 


Again  14B+10G = 4days


 => 56B+40G =1


 


so, here it is clear that either we employ 36B and 48G to finish the work in 1 day or 56B and 40G to finish the same job in 1 day. thus , we can say


 => 36B+48G = 56B+40G


 => G= 2.5B


Thus a Girl is 2.5 times as efficient as a boy.


 


Now, since  36B+48G = 1


 => 36B+48(2.5 B)=1


 =>156B=1


i.e., to finish the job in 1 day 156 boys are required or the amount of work is 156 boys-days


 


Again    1G+1B=2.5B+1B=3.5B


 


Now, since 156 boys can finish the job in 1 day


so 1 boy can finish the job in 156 days


Therefore, 3.5 boys can finish the job in 1×1563.5= 47 days.

Q:

There is sufficient salary to give K for 10 days and L for 15 days. Then how many days will the money last if both has to be given the salary ?

A) 6 days B) 12 days
C) 4 days D) 9 days
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: A) 6 days

Explanation:

K's 1 day's salary = 1/10
L's 1 day's salary = 1/15
Together their 1 day's salary = 1/10 + 1/15
= 3/30 + 2/30
= 5/30
= 1/6
So the money will be enough for paying them both for 6 days.
